Transaction 5984dfc1c046a9d05e06c270089832a58822276800022dfea7908fabe1cb20ba
1 Input
1 Output
-
5984dfc1c046a9d05e06c270089832a58822276800022dfea7908fabe1cb20ba:0
- value
- 11218005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46534ec3ff215dcb077db1d74d6e6a3189777ac4 OP_EQUAL
- address
- 386s2HpdkGj6TUu9ECaHF1g2otuhoP368k